This series lets MPTCP applications use poll(EPOLLERR) and
recvmsg(MSG_ERRQUEUE) on the MPTCP socket to drain TX timestamps
through the standard inet ABI, the same way they would on a plain TCP
socket. ICMP-derived errors stay on the subflow queue: the legacy
RECVERR ABI cannot convey their per-subflow peer identity, and they
are intended for a future MPTCP_RECERR channel.

- Patch 1 splices subflow err-skbs onto the MPTCP's sk_error_queue at
  error-report time. All forwarded events go through sock_queue_err_skb,
  which re-homes skb->sk onto the MPTCP and charges sk_rmem_alloc, so
  the MPTCP's error queue stays bounded by sk_rcvbuf and is dropped under
  rmem pressure, matching tcp's tx-timestamp path and ip_icmp_error() /
  ipv6_icmp_error(). mptcp_recvmsg(MSG_ERRQUEUE) forwards directly to
  inet_recv_error(), and mptcp_poll() advertises EPOLLERR purely on the
  MPTCP's sk_err / sk_error_queue, matching tcp_poll().

- Patch 2 factors the existing inet_flags subflow-propagation hard-coded
  list into a mask, so the next patch can extend it without churn.

- Patch 3 makes IP_RECVERR / IPV6_RECVERR (and the RFC4884 variants)
  propagate to the subflows. The MPTCP stores the bit so MPTCP-aware
  helpers can branch on it.

- Patch 4 is a selftest covering the propagation path.
